Output d93e66d23ab13f1544ad80c8b6d619adea0050c5e08d8d00264c51c64b2489dc:19

value
250655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f4814dd74a914c70b07aea04c5af6c1c2e638f OP_EQUAL
address
3GpWKhzPvDNY5EsPuZcTfwnhaCpPSruayP
transaction
d93e66d23ab13f1544ad80c8b6d619adea0050c5e08d8d00264c51c64b2489dc
spent
true